What is the Age Pension?
The Age Pension is a government-funded financial assistance program for Australians aged 67 and older who meet residency, income, and asset tests.
Payments are reviewed and adjusted twice a year (March and September) to ensure pensioners keep pace with inflation.

Eligibility for the Age Pension in 2025
To qualify for the Age Pension, applicants must meet four key criteria:
1. Age Requirement
- You must be 67 years or older in 2025.
2. Residency Status
- You must be an Australian citizen or permanent resident.
- You must have lived in Australia for at least 10 years, including a continuous period of 5 years.
3. Income Test
The pension is reduced if you earn above the income limits:
Category | Maximum Earnings Before Reduction | Reduction Rate |
---|---|---|
Single | $204 per fortnight | Pension reduced by 50 cents for every $1 earned above limit |
Couple (Combined) | $360 per fortnight | 50 cents reduction per dollar earned |
4. Assets Test
If your total assets exceed the limits below, your pension payment may be reduced:
Category | Homeowners | Non-Homeowners |
---|---|---|
Single | $301,750 | $543,750 |
Couple (Combined) | $451,500 | $693,500 |
If your income or assets exceed these limits, your pension may be reduced or not available.
